AgentiveAIQ is a next‑generation, no‑code AI chatbot platform that empowers tree‑service businesses to generate, qualify, and nurture leads directly on their website. The platform’s standout WYSIWYG chat widget editor allows marketers to design a floating or embedded chat experience that matches their brand colors, logo, and typography without writing a single line of code. Behind the scenes, AgentiveAIQ deploys a dual knowledge‑base architecture: a Retrieval‑Augmented Generation (RAG) engine pulls facts from uploaded documents, while a semantic Knowledge Graph understands relationships between concepts—ideal for answering nuanced questions about tree species, pruning schedules, or safety regulations. For companies that host training or certification content, the platform offers AI‑powered courses and password‑protected hosted pages. Users can embed these pages on their own domain; when visitors log in, the system provides persistent, long‑term memory that remembers past interactions, enabling personalized follow‑ups and accurate quoting. However, this memory feature is limited to authenticated users on hosted pages and is not available for anonymous website visitors using the chat widget. AgentiveAIQ’s pricing tiers start at $39/month for basic use, $129/month for the popular Pro plan—unlocking smart triggers, webhooks, and Shopify/WooCommerce e‑commerce integrations—and $449/month for the Agency plan, which adds 50 hosted pages, a dedicated account manager, and full brand‑free deployment.

Intercom

Best for: Mid‑size tree‑service firms that need a unified platform for live chat, email, and bot automation with deep CRM connectivity.

Visit Site

Intercom is a customer messaging platform that combines live chat, bots, and product tours to engage website visitors. For tree‑service businesses, Intercom’s chatbot can collect contact details, schedule appointments, and provide instant answers to common questions about services. Its visual flow builder allows marketers to set up conversational paths without coding, while integrations with Salesforce, HubSpot, and Zapier enable automated lead routing. Intercom also offers a rich set of pre‑built templates for support, sales, and marketing, making it easy to get started. However, the platform’s pricing can be steep for small teams, and the chatbot engine is less focused on knowledge‑base retrieval compared to specialized AI providers. Intercom’s strength lies in its robust user segmentation, targeted messaging, and strong customer support.

HubSpot Chatbot Builder

Best for: Tree‑service companies already invested in HubSpot’s marketing stack who need to capture leads directly on their website.

Visit Site

HubSpot’s free chatbot builder is part of the larger HubSpot CRM ecosystem. It allows tree‑service businesses to create conversational forms that capture leads, qualify prospects, and route them to the appropriate sales or support team. The builder offers a drag‑and‑drop interface and integrates natively with HubSpot’s contact database, making follow‑up automation seamless. While the chatbot is powerful for lead capture, it relies on static form logic rather than dynamic knowledge retrieval. HubSpot’s strength is its ability to tag leads, score them, and trigger email sequences based on user responses. The platform is ideal for businesses already using HubSpot for marketing automation.

ManyChat

Best for: Tree‑service businesses looking for a low‑cost, multi‑channel chatbot that can broadcast promotions and capture leads via Messenger and web chat.

Visit Site

ManyChat is a conversational marketing platform primarily focused on Facebook Messenger, but it also supports web chat widgets. It provides a visual flow builder that lets tree‑service operators design automated conversations to capture leads, send appointment reminders, and send promotional offers. ManyChat integrates with Mailchimp, HubSpot, and Zapier, allowing leads to be added to email lists or CRM systems. The platform offers broadcasting features for mass messaging and basic analytics. However, ManyChat’s knowledge‑base capabilities are limited; it relies on predefined responses rather than dynamic content retrieval.

Tidio

Best for: Small tree‑service companies seeking an all‑in‑one chat solution without a steep learning curve.

Visit Site

Tidio blends live chat and chatbot functionalities into a single widget that can be embedded on a website. Its drag‑and‑drop chatbot editor allows tree‑service operators to create automated responses to common questions about pricing, scheduling, and service coverage. Tidio integrates with popular CRMs like HubSpot, Zoho, and Mailchimp, and supports email notifications for new leads. The platform offers a free plan with basic chatbot features and a paid plan that unlocks advanced AI responses, multi‑agent chat, and additional integrations. Tidio’s AI is less sophisticated than specialized providers but can still handle simple FAQ-style interactions.

Zoho SalesIQ

Best for: Tree‑service operators already using Zoho CRM who want a unified chat and visitor analytics solution.

Visit Site

Zoho SalesIQ is a live chat and website visitor tracking tool that includes a chatbot component. It allows tree‑service businesses to engage visitors, capture contact information, and route leads to sales reps. SalesIQ integrates tightly with Zoho CRM, enabling automatic lead creation and scoring. The chatbot editor is code‑free and supports custom scripts for more advanced flows. The platform also provides real‑time visitor analytics, heatmaps, and a knowledge‑base module for FAQ answers. Pricing starts at $18/month for a single user, scaling with the number of agents and features.

Drift

Best for: Large tree‑service enterprises with complex sales cycles and a need for integrated B2B lead qualification.

Visit Site

Drift is a conversational marketing platform focused on B2B lead generation. It offers a chatbot that can qualify prospects, book meetings, and provide instant answers to product or service questions. The platform’s visual flow builder and AI assistant help tree‑service businesses create personalized experiences. Drift integrates with Salesforce, HubSpot, and Marketo, enabling seamless lead management. However, Drift’s pricing is comparatively high, with plans starting at $400/month, which may be prohibitive for small or mid‑size tree‑service firms. Its chatbot is designed for complex B2B workflows rather than the more straightforward lead capture needs of a local tree‑care provider.
